2. Elective vs. diagnostic
A crucial distinction influencing the price of 3D ultrasound is whether or not the process is deemed elective or diagnostic. This categorization considerably impacts insurance coverage protection and consequently, out-of-pocket bills. Diagnostic ultrasounds are medically essential procedures carried out to evaluate fetal improvement and determine potential anomalies. These scans are usually coated by medical health insurance, topic to coverage specifics and deductible necessities. Conversely, elective 3D ultrasounds are hunted for non-medical causes, primarily to acquire memento photographs and movies. Attributable to their non-essential nature, elective ultrasounds are typically not coated by insurance coverage, leaving sufferers answerable for the complete price.
This distinction creates a notable value disparity. A diagnostic ultrasound, usually built-in into routine prenatal care, could incur a small copay or be absolutely coated. An elective 3D ultrasound, nevertheless, can vary from $100 to $300 or extra, relying on the clinic and bundle chosen. For instance, a affected person requiring a diagnostic ultrasound to guage fetal progress would possibly pay a $25 copay, whereas one other affected person looking for a 3D ultrasound solely for memento photographs on the similar clinic may face a $200 charge. Understanding this distinction is essential for budgeting and making knowledgeable selections concerning prenatal imaging.
The elective vs. diagnostic classification straight impacts affected person monetary accountability for 3D ultrasound. Recognizing this distinction empowers sufferers to navigate the prices related to these procedures successfully. Whereas insurance coverage usually covers medically essential diagnostic scans, the expense of elective scans falls solely on the affected person. Subsequently, cautious consideration of the aim and related prices is significant when deciding between diagnostic and elective 3D ultrasounds.
3. Gestational Age
Gestational age considerably influences the readability and diagnostic worth of 3D ultrasound photographs, not directly affecting the general price. Earlier in being pregnant, the fetus is smaller and surrounded by extra amniotic fluid, creating optimum situations for detailed imaging. As being pregnant progresses, the out there house decreases, and fetal bones start to harden, doubtlessly obscuring finer anatomical particulars. Subsequently, optimum imaging home windows exist for various anatomical constructions. For instance, facial options are usually finest visualized between 24 and 30 weeks, whereas skeletal constructions develop into clearer in later phases. Whereas the price of the ultrasound itself could not change straight with gestational age, the standard and diagnostic yield can differ, influencing the perceived worth and potential want for extra scans. Selecting the suitable gestational age for a 3D ultrasound maximizes the probabilities of acquiring clear and informative photographs.
This hyperlink between gestational age and picture high quality has sensible implications for each elective and diagnostic scans. For elective 3D ultrasounds looking for optimum facial visualization, scheduling between 24 and 30 weeks is usually really helpful. In diagnostic situations, the timing of the ultrasound is dictated by the particular scientific query. For example, evaluating suspected cardiac anomalies would possibly require imaging at a selected gestational age when the center is optimally developed. Moreover, limitations imposed by later gestational ages would possibly necessitate different imaging modalities, like MRI, which may incur further prices. Subsequently, understanding the interaction between gestational age and imaging high quality facilitates knowledgeable decision-making and optimizes useful resource allocation.
In abstract, gestational age acts as a vital determinant of picture high quality and diagnostic functionality in 3D ultrasound. Whereas the direct price of the process stays comparatively fixed, the scientific worth and potential want for supplementary imaging differ considerably with fetal improvement. Recognizing this interdependence ensures applicable timing for each elective and diagnostic functions, maximizing the advantages of 3D ultrasound expertise.
4. Further Companies (e.g., DVDs)
Further companies provided by 3D ultrasound suppliers considerably impression the general price of the process. These non-compulsory extras cater to the wishes of expectant mother and father to protect recollections and share the expertise with family members. Understanding the vary of those companies and their related prices permits for knowledgeable decision-making and price range planning.
-
Digital Media (DVDs, USB Drives)
Many clinics provide digital recordings of the 3D ultrasound session on DVDs or USB drives. These recordings seize the real-time photographs and sometimes embody heartbeat audio. This supplies a long-lasting memento for folks and permits them to share the expertise with household and mates. The price of these digital media varies relying on the clinic and the format supplied, usually including $20-$50 to the full expense.
-
Prints and Images
Excessive-quality prints or pictures of key ultrasound photographs are a preferred add-on. These present tangible mementos of the expertise and may be displayed within the dwelling or shared with family members. Clinics usually provide varied print sizes and packages, influencing the related price, which may vary from $10 for a single print to $50 or extra for a bundle of a number of prints and varied sizes.
-
Prolonged Session Time
Customary 3D ultrasound periods have a typical length. Nonetheless, some clinics provide prolonged periods for a further charge, permitting extra time for picture seize, doubtlessly clearer views, and a extra complete expertise. This feature caters to folks who need an extended, extra in-depth session, usually including $50-$100 to the bottom value.
-
Gender Reveal Add-ons
For fogeys who want to uncover the child’s gender in the course of the ultrasound, some clinics provide particular gender reveal packages. These usually embody sealed envelopes containing the gender data, coloured confetti cannons, or different celebratory gadgets. These add-ons contribute to the general price, including anyplace from $25-$75, relying on the specifics of the bundle.
The cumulative price of those further companies can considerably affect the full expenditure for a 3D ultrasound. Whereas the bottom value of the process covers the core imaging service, choosing a number of add-ons can considerably improve the ultimate invoice. Subsequently, cautious consideration of desired extras and their related prices is important for managing expectations and budgeting appropriately. Evaluating bundle offers and particular person service costs throughout completely different clinics empowers knowledgeable decision-making and cost-effective planning.
5. Package deal Offers
Package deal offers play a major position within the total price of 3D ultrasounds. These bundles usually mix the core 3D ultrasound service with varied add-ons, providing potential price financial savings in comparison with buying every merchandise individually. Understanding the composition and pricing construction of bundle offers is essential for knowledgeable decision-making and maximizing worth.
Usually, bundle offers incorporate a number of parts. A fundamental bundle would possibly embody the 3D ultrasound scan, a restricted variety of printed photographs, and a digital recording on a DVD or USB drive. Extra complete packages can embody further prints, longer session durations, gender reveal add-ons, and different premium options. For example, a clinic would possibly provide a “bronze” bundle for $150, together with a fundamental scan and some prints, a “silver” bundle for $225 with added digital recording and extra prints, and a “gold” bundle for $300 encompassing prolonged session time and all out there add-ons. These tiered choices cater to various budgets and preferences, permitting people to pick the bundle finest suited to their wants.
Cautious analysis of bundle offers is important for optimizing expenditure. Evaluating the full price of a bundle to the person costs of its parts reveals potential financial savings. For instance, buying a scan, digital recording, and prints individually would possibly whole $250, whereas a bundle providing the identical options for $200 represents a major saving. Nonetheless, pointless inclusions in a bundle can negate any price advantages. A bundle priced at $275 containing options valued at $200 individually based mostly on particular wants supplies no monetary benefit. Subsequently, understanding particular person wants and preferences in relation to bundle contents is essential for knowledgeable choice and maximizing the worth of bundle offers.
6. Insurance coverage Protection
Insurance coverage protection performs a pivotal position in figuring out the out-of-pocket price of a 3D ultrasound. Whereas diagnostic ultrasounds are sometimes coated as medically essential procedures, elective 3D ultrasounds typically lack protection. Understanding insurance coverage coverage specifics is essential for managing expectations and navigating potential bills.
-
Medical Necessity vs. Elective Procedures
Insurance coverage firms distinguish between medically essential diagnostic procedures and elective procedures like 3D ultrasounds for memento photographs. Diagnostic ultrasounds, important for monitoring fetal well being and detecting potential anomalies, are usually coated below commonplace prenatal care advantages, topic to deductible and copay necessities. Conversely, elective 3D ultrasounds, primarily hunted for non-medical functions, are hardly ever coated, inserting the monetary accountability solely on the affected person.
-
Pre-authorization and Coverage Limitations
Even for medically essential ultrasounds, pre-authorization from the insurance coverage supplier is likely to be required. Insurance policies usually specify protection limits, together with the variety of ultrasounds coated throughout a being pregnant and the particular forms of scans allowed. Exceeding these limits or present process uncovered procedures could end in denied claims, shifting the monetary burden to the affected person. Contacting the insurance coverage supplier to know coverage limitations and pre-authorization necessities is significant.
-
Out-of-Community Suppliers
Using out-of-network ultrasound suppliers can considerably impression protection. In-network suppliers have pre-negotiated charges with insurance coverage firms, resulting in decrease out-of-pocket prices for sufferers. Utilizing out-of-network suppliers could end in larger bills attributable to decreased protection or full denial of claims. Verifying community participation earlier than scheduling an ultrasound is important for cost-effective care.
-
Interesting Denied Claims
In instances the place insurance coverage claims for medically essential ultrasounds are denied, sufferers have the choice to enchantment the choice. A profitable enchantment, supported by medical documentation justifying the need of the process, could end in retroactive protection. Understanding the appeals course of and diligently pursuing claims may help mitigate out-of-pocket bills. Persistence and correct documentation are key to profitable declare appeals.
Subsequently, insurance coverage protection concerns considerably affect the price of 3D ultrasounds. Differentiating between diagnostic and elective procedures, understanding coverage limitations, verifying community participation, and pursuing appeals for denied claims are essential steps in navigating insurance coverage complexities and managing related bills. Proactive communication with the insurance coverage supplier is paramount for minimizing monetary surprises and guaranteeing applicable protection.
